I have travel danced...

I am from the Detroit area where you have to have a Detroit dance card in order to work.

Las Vegas you need a card and Atlanta you need a card.

Not sure what type of club you work at, but good questions to ask are 1. Do they accept traveling dancers 2. Do u need to bring anything other than your ID (some places want Social security card) & 3. What type of club-cuz some are full nude, some are pasties clubs, some are grown clubs etc so u wanna know what to pack.

I would suggest certainly calling ahead of time to see if they hire traveling dancers, and if so, if they require a permit. Ask dance prices, dress codes, house fees, etc. Some places have employee housing so it’s worth asking that. I would also suggest taking a mini vacation to that area first if you can, just to see different clubs and if they’re somewhere you’d actually want to work. You can write that trip off as a business expense as well. I know I’m late to the game but I hope someone finds this helpful!
